One Year Later
http://www.time.com/time/asia/covers/501031013/story.html
The Bali bombings were perpetrated by extremist outsiders. Yet they
have led many Balinese to wonder if they brought this evil upon
themselves—and what they must do to set things right
By Jamie James
Posted Monday, October 6, 2003; 21:00 HKT
Agus Suardana's wife, Komang, told him about the bombs. The telephone
had rung in the predawn darkness, as it did in many homes in Bali the
morning after Oct. 12, 2002. "Komang answered it," Agus, a slight,
sunny-faced hotel executive, recalled. "She woke me up and said there
had been a bomb in Kuta. I told her it can't be, it can't happen to
us. In Bali we have thousands of gods to protect us."
